Ordinals
beta
Sat 478419293617414
decimal
16546.15493617414
percentile
0.9568385872348281%
name
mltuodfcpmpv
cycle
0
epoch
2
block
16546
offset
15493617414
timestamp
2023-12-18 08:49:55 UTC
rarity
common
prev
next